The Service May Be Ghastly

Anyone can offer you a set of services for any price they choose. The question is, what is the quality of their work? Do they have certifications from the plumbing industry to prove they have the qualifications to do this job? If all they have is a lowball estimate with no customer reviews to back up their claims, you should probably move on.

There May Be Hidden Fees

If the total amount of the estimate seems farfetched, it most likely is. Now is the time to put your suspicions to the test. The reason they may feel so secure in offering you a ridiculously low price upfront is because they have backloaded it with hidden fees. Some companies get their foot in the door then add on later.

Quality of Materials

One reason for a difference in price could be the materials quoted. Watch out for a difference in quality, which ultimately affects dependibility, life-expectancy, and efficiency of a plumbing fixture, for example a tankless water heater.
